2007 Toyota Tundra Limited 4dr CrewMax Cab 4WD SB (5.7L 8cyl 6A)

Review

Like everything about this truck except for one unfortunate issue. The six speed auto seems to randomly start vibrating as if going over a rumble strip. It feels like a torque converter issue. Picked up from dealer today after they evaluated it. They are going to replace the transmission which only has about 800 miles on it. What adds insult to injury is that they are replacing this with a rebuilt unit. I for one havent had real good luck with other rebuilt auto parts. Service said Toyota wouldnt let them order a new one. They had their crankshaft issue earlier this year now it appears the transmission may be an issue. This truck cost almost 50k!

Favorite Features

Styling, interior room.

Suggested Improvements

Quality control, and HEY TOYOTA when a transmission goes bad with less than 800 miles on it why insult the customer and replace it with a rebuilt that could have 30k or more on its components. Standard satellite radio.

2007 Toyota Tundra SR5 4dr Double Cab SB (5.7L 8cyl 6A)

Review

As a tow vehicle the engine, with 401 ft. lbs. of torque coupled with a six speed transmission and 4.30 final drive ratio, is a lot closer to diesel performance than I had expected. The other surprise is general acceleration. Right off the showroom floor, typical stop light to stop light runs leave many "performance" cars struggling to keep up. The seats and seating position are very comfortable and except for the interior design of the dash, Toyota engineering has raised the bar for trucks in this class. So far it's been a win-win situation.

Favorite Features

The engine and drivetrain are the crown jewels for this vehicle, clearly outclassing anything in its field of 1/2 ton trucks. The general level of driver comfort is also a big plus at the end of a hard day.

Suggested Improvements

The exterior design of the bland truck sides could be a little more decisive in appearance. Bottom panels connecting wheel flares would help to segment the vertical sides and would emphasize the horizontal character of the truck.

2007 Toyota Tundra SR5 4dr Double Cab SB (4.7L 8cyl 5A)

Review

I test drove both the 5.7 V8 and the 4.7L V8 and decided on the 4.7L because I didn't need the towing capacity and wanted a truck that had more options for the price (instead of the the bigger engine). The 270hp/313lb-ft 4.7L is more than adequate for my commute and the occasional tow. Coupled with the 5 speed it is surprisingly nimble in traffic (I must compliment the 5.7L V8 though - the test drive ALMOST had it sold. That truck moves effortlessly.) The truck bed is huge and it's difficult to reach over the side to get anything (I'm 5'11"). The ride is comfortable, but the interior isn't as nice as the Silverado (as expected). Overall it's great - no buyer's remorse here!

Favorite Features

Auto stability control (which does work - I've used it!), 4 wheel disc brakes, 6 disc CD changer, JBL sound system with bluetooth for cell phones, tough looks, head turning styling, nimbleness for a full size truck.

Suggested Improvements

The back seat in the double cab is spacious, but some small layout changes would make it "feel" bigger. I wouldn't want to be back there on a 6+ hr trip.
